Lowering Mast Type Windsock Pole Manufacturer in Saudi Arabia
A Lowering Mast Type Windsock Pole is a steel mast fitted with a windsock at its top, designed to indicate wind direction and approximate speed at helipads, airports, offshore platforms, and industrial sites, while allowing the entire mast to be lowered to ground level for windsock replacement, lighting maintenance, or inspection without the need for climbing equipment.
Century Experts fabricates Lowering Mast Type Windsock Poles from corrosion-resistant structural steel, welded by qualified personnel under approved procedures, with a hinged base and winch or gas-strut lowering mechanism that lets a single technician safely tilt the mast down for servicing. This is especially valuable in offshore and refinery environments where working at height carries additional risk and permit requirements.

1. What is a Lowering Mast Type Windsock Pole?
A Lowering Mast Type Windsock Pole is a steel mast carrying a windsock at its top for wind direction indication, built with a hinged base so the entire mast can be tilted down to ground level for maintenance, rather than requiring a technician to climb it.
2. Why choose a lowering mast instead of a fixed pole?
A fixed windsock pole requires ladder access, scaffolding, or fall protection equipment to replace the windsock or service the lighting, while a lowering mast allows this to be done safely at ground level, which is especially useful on offshore platforms and refineries where working at height requires additional permits and precautions.
3. How is the mast lowered and raised?
The mast pivots on a hinged base and is lowered using either a manual winch and cable system or a gas-strut assist mechanism, allowing one person to safely control the descent and return the mast to its upright, locked position after servicing.
